
Amaravati, December 15:
Andhra Pradesh has won the National Energy Conservation Award for the fourth consecutive year, recognising the state’s consistent performance in promoting energy efficiency and sustainable practices. The award was given for the successful implementation of energy-saving initiatives across various sectors, including industry, power distribution and public infrastructure.
Officials said the achievement reflects the state government’s long-term focus on reducing energy consumption and promoting renewable energy solutions. The recognition further strengthens Andhra Pradesh’s reputation as a leader in sustainable development and responsible energy management at the national level.
